Ejector pumps in Country Club Hills homes work silently in the background — until they stop. J. Blanton Plumbing responds quickly to ejector pump failures because sewage backup is not a situation that can wait.

Our Country Club Hills plumbers inspect the entire ejector system: the pump, the pit, the check valve, the vent line, and the float switch. A failing check valve, for example, can cause the pump to cycle repeatedly and burn out prematurely — something that is easy to overlook without a thorough inspection.

We also install battery backup systems for ejector pumps, so your basement fixtures continue to drain even during a power outage — a smart upgrade for any Country Club Hills home with a finished basement.

A sump pump removes groundwater from the sump pit to prevent flooding. An ejector pump handles sewage and wastewater from below-grade plumbing fixtures (basement toilets, sinks, and laundry) and pumps it up to the main sewer line.

A quality ejector pump typically lasts 7 to 10 years with normal use. Pumps in homes with heavy basement fixture use or that handle laundry water may have a shorter lifespan. Annual inspection helps catch wear before failure.

Sewage odors near the ejector pit usually indicate a cracked or improperly sealed pit cover, a failed vent line, or a pit that needs cleaning. Our plumbers inspect and seal the system to eliminate the odor.
